Nine people have been killed after a student opened fire at a school in Turkey's southern Kahramanmaras region, local governor Mukerrem Unluer said on Wednesday. The governor said the fatalities included eight students and a teacher. A further 13 people were injured, six of whom were in a serious condition, Interior Minister Mustafa Ciftci said. The attacker was also killed, with reports saying he had taken his own life. What do we know about the Turkey shooting so far? "A student came to school with guns that we believe belonged to his father in his backpack. He entered two classrooms and opened fire randomly, causing injuries and deaths," Unluer told reporters.  Police and ambulances were sent to the scene after reports of intense gunfire. Local media named the scene of the incident as Ayser Calik Middle School in Onikisubat district. Unluer said the attacker had been in eighth-grade, so between 13 and 14 years of age.…
